*{box-sizing:border-box}html{scroll-behavior:smooth}html,body{overflow-x:clip;max-width:100%}@keyframes spin{to{transform:rotate(360deg)}}body{margin:0;background-color:#f8f1e4;color:#2e2a22;font-family:Poppins,-apple-system,system-ui,Segoe UI,sans-serif;-webkit-font-smoothing:antialiased}h1,h2,h3,h4{font-family:Playfair Display,Georgia,serif;margin:0}p{margin:0}img{display:block;max-width:100%}button,input,textarea,select{font-family:inherit}a{text-decoration:none;color:inherit}@media (max-width: 768px){input,select,textarea{font-size:16px!important}}.hera-cta{position:relative;overflow:hidden;isolation:isolate;transition:transform .4s cubic-bezier(.2,.7,.2,1),box-shadow .4s ease,filter .4s ease}.hera-cta:after{content:"";position:absolute;top:0;bottom:0;left:-160%;width:55%;background:linear-gradient(105deg,transparent 35%,rgba(255,255,255,.5) 50%,transparent 65%);transform:skew(-18deg);pointer-events:none;animation:hera-sheen 5.5s ease-in-out infinite}.hera-cta:hover{transform:translateY(-3px);box-shadow:0 16px 40px #b0892f80;filter:saturate(1.05) brightness(1.03)}.hera-cta:active{transform:translateY(-1px) scale(.99)}@keyframes hera-sheen{0%,14%{left:-160%}50%,to{left:175%}}.hera-nav{position:relative}.hera-nav:after{content:"";position:absolute;left:0;right:0;bottom:0;height:2px;background:linear-gradient(90deg,transparent,#C9A24B 18%,#B0892F 82%,transparent);border-radius:2px;transform:scaleX(0);transform-origin:center;opacity:0;transition:transform .4s cubic-bezier(.2,.7,.2,1),opacity .3s ease}.hera-nav:hover:after{transform:scaleX(.65);opacity:.65}.hera-nav.is-active:after{transform:scaleX(1);opacity:1}.hera-nav.is-active{text-shadow:0 0 16px rgba(201,162,75,.4)}.hera-flourish{transform-origin:center;animation:hera-flourish 4.2s ease-in-out infinite;box-shadow:0 2px 10px #c9a24b59}@keyframes hera-flourish{0%,to{transform:scaleX(1);opacity:.9}50%{transform:scaleX(1.18);opacity:1}}.hera-kenburns{transform:scale(1);animation:hera-kenburns 22s ease-in-out infinite alternate;will-change:transform}@keyframes hera-kenburns{0%{transform:scale(1) translate(0)}to{transform:scale(1.12) translate(-1.5%,-1.5%)}}@media (prefers-reduced-motion: reduce){.hera-cta:after{animation:none}.hera-cta,.hera-nav:after{transition:none}.hera-flourish,.hera-kenburns{animation:none}}[data-admin-theme]{transition:background-color .25s ease,color .25s ease}[data-admin-theme=light]{--adm-bg-gradient: linear-gradient(180deg, #FBF7EF 0%, #F6EEDE 100%);--adm-surface: #FFFFFF;--adm-surface-soft: rgba(20,42,58,.045);--adm-surface-hover: rgba(20,42,58,.085);--adm-text: #2E2A22;--adm-text-muted: #6E6456;--adm-border: rgba(42,38,32,.12);--adm-topbar: rgba(251,247,239,.85);--adm-photo-scrim: linear-gradient(150deg, rgba(255,250,242,.93), rgba(255,250,242,.83));--adm-grid: rgba(42,38,32,.06)}[data-admin-theme=dark]{--adm-bg-gradient: linear-gradient(180deg, #0E2A3A 0%, #0A2230 100%);--adm-surface: #143A4F;--adm-surface-soft: rgba(255,255,255,.05);--adm-surface-hover: rgba(255,255,255,.085);--adm-text: #F3ECDB;--adm-text-muted: #B9C4CB;--adm-border: rgba(255,255,255,.12);--adm-topbar: rgba(8,20,32,.78);--adm-photo-scrim: linear-gradient(150deg, rgba(10,22,34,.93), rgba(10,22,34,.82));--adm-grid: rgba(255,255,255,.04)}
